Hi Rob,

According to our records less then 15 OSTC1 are out there, since we offer a very good upgrade offer to a new 2N (Contact us for details: info@heinrichsweikamp.com). Keeping the OSTC1 firmware up-to-date for the much smaller display is just impossible. Most of the new features are hard-connected to the new display, so we don't update the OSTC1 code anymore.
1.80 does not give incorrect deco information, but the safety margins have been increased since then.
